  • System Requirements

  • Min Processor TypeIntel Pentium - 133 MHz
  • Min RAM Size72 MB
  • Interface DevicesMouse or compatible device, CD-ROM, SVGA monitor
  • Other RequirementMicrosoft Windows 98 - RAM 32 MB Microsoft Windows 98 Second Edition - RAM 32 MB Microsoft Windows Millennium Edition - RAM 40 MB Microsoft Windows NT 4.0 SP6 or later - RAM 40 MB Microsoft Windows 2000 Professional - RAM 72 MB
  • OS RequirementMicrosoft Windows 98, Microsoft Windows 98 Second Edition, Microsoft Windows Millennium Edition, Microsoft Windows 2000 or later, Microsoft Windows XP, Microsoft Windows NT 4.0 SP6 or later
